Transaction fc52ae65b2f154a45582542c2530b7584f16e76015907bb4392c4d51908f80e6
1 Input
1 Output
-
fc52ae65b2f154a45582542c2530b7584f16e76015907bb4392c4d51908f80e6:0
- value
- 59350365
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4cba27934d5888eb60fe3b9c60e0dbe938e3d51 OP_EQUAL
- address
- 3M6B7zjLafc67ZYqM1rcSZuEWadnkRuSHC